Package: tcptrace Version: 6.6.7-4.1 Severity: normal File: /usr/bin/tcptrace
Dear Maintainer,
* What led up to the situation?
While developing a new fuzzer we discovered this bug.
* What outcome did you expect instead?
We expected the program not to crash. I'm attaching an input file that
triggers this bug. The bug can be triggered on x86_64 as well.
Here's a stack trace:
"""
Ostermann's tcptrace -- version 6.6.7 -- Thu Nov 4, 2004
TCP packet 10: reserved bits are not all zero.
Further warnings disabled, use '-w' for more info
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
0x08058ecc in MemCpy (vp1=0x80caab0, vp2=0x80baab6, n=4294699681) at
tcptrace.c:2620
2620 *p1++=*p2++;
(gdb) bt
#0 0x08058ecc in MemCpy (vp1=0x80caab0, vp2=0x80baab6, n=4294699681) at
tcptrace.c:2620
#1 0x080558c4 in callback (user=0x0, phdr=0xbffff1bc, buf=0x80baaa8 "")
at tcpdump.c:166
#2 0xb7f4ba18 in pcap_offline_read (p=0x80ba8a0, cnt=1,
callback=0x8055850 <callback>,
user=0x0) at ./savefile.c:404
#3 0xb7f3c8f6 in pcap_dispatch (p=0x80ba8a0, cnt=1, callback=0x8055850
<callback>,
user=0x0) at ./pcap.c:829
#4 0x080556d8 in pread_tcpdump (ptime=0x80a75c8 <current_time>,
plen=0xbffff29c,
ptlen=0xbffff2a0, pphys=0xbffff298, pphystype=0xbffff294,
ppip=0xbffff28c,
pplast=0xbffff2a4) at tcpdump.c:247
#5 0x08058098 in ProcessFile (filename=0x80caab0 "E`") at tcptrace.c:966
#6 0x08049fba in main (argc=1, argv=0xbffff4f4) at tcptrace.c:785
"""
